Ticket MIG-providing context for reviewer: the zero-downtime schema migration pipeline for Tidewell's orders service failed overnight because the migration runner's credentials expired mid-expand phase. The contract phase never ran, so both column versions still exist and dual-writes are active. I have rotated the runner credential; please verify the new value is correctly scoped before we resume. The replacement key follows:

service key, fawip-bajef: kto11_Qt5wZK9vdNC

Subject: Handover — cron migration to Orchestrelle

Welcome aboard. Short version: all nightly cron jobs on the old Brindlehost boxes are moving to the Orchestrelle workflow engine by end of quarter. Twelve jobs migrated, nine remain — list is in the migration tracker. Priority is the ledger-export job; it's fragile. Don't touch the legacy crontabs until the parallel runs match for three consecutive nights. Orchestrelle deploys require signed bundles, and the deploy key you'll need is below.

deploy key for kajof-fajop: bky6_gDHw9Q

Ticket CWG-412: Crossword generator produces unsolvable grids on themed puzzles

Welcome aboard — context for you: the Puzzlewright engine occasionally emits grids where a themed answer crosses a slot with no valid fill, so the solver deadlocks. Repro: generate any 15x15 with the "harvest" theme pack and seed mode off. Suspect the constraint pruning added in the Marrowgate refactor; it drops candidates too aggressively. Please attach solver logs to your findings. The build token for the affected release is recorded below.

session token of yajof-bagef = htk4_937d